Output 28629ee7aed023d3a0394756898c1ecde26c2a2fe8f0c91eabda659e39d25268:0

value
37757
script pubkey
OP_0 OP_PUSHBYTES_20 cefbeb76bb1fa30648c6d07933eaa39c69bc38af
address
bc1qema7ka4mr73svjxx6pun864rn35mcw90c64jjk
transaction
28629ee7aed023d3a0394756898c1ecde26c2a2fe8f0c91eabda659e39d25268
confirmations
128169
spent
true